On the American League side, the Detroit Tigers sit atop the AL Central with a narrow lead over the Cleveland Guardians. Yet, their recent struggles—an 0-6 home stand against Cleveland and Atlanta—cast doubt on their prospects. Since July 8th, Detroit has been just 26-37, with their pitching staff and offense struggling to find consistency. If they fail to clinch, it would mark the largest combined lead blown in modern AL/NL history without a division crown—an all-time embarrassing collapse.
